The ps lower line is still in warentee. I come across 1 ps lower hose a day. Also, check your ps reservoir seal, they like to leak too. As for the rear latch, I replace a few of them, they are somewhat of a common problem with door latches as well.

Renato, you can change the trans fluid at 60k. while at it. I recommend changing the transfer case fluid as well. When changing the trans fluid, I recommend going to the dealer and ask them for a "Trans Flush."
